Output 86befecac0813252b8b0a87a156053c8a37027a7633349fe5b05241d54c501de:2

value
103876185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 437ff857d4537f772efe773be4a3d978c18ccec0 OP_EQUAL
address
ME44ooPNTaF8NnobLYCNfQGRPS3FE5vEfq
transaction
86befecac0813252b8b0a87a156053c8a37027a7633349fe5b05241d54c501de
spent
true